WTW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2023 in Review

628 of the 6,859 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Willis Towers Watson (WTW) for Q4 2023, worth a combined $23.2B — up 15% from $20.1B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 121 funds opened new WTW positions and 43 closed out — a net gain of 78 holders — while 197 added to existing stakes and 227 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Victory Capital Management, adding an estimated $334M. The largest seller was Cantillon Capital Management, exiting entirely with an estimated $392M sold.
